### v3.2.0 — Renamed setting

Keyspindle no longer reads `KS_ROTATE_TOKEN`; it was renamed for consistency with the plugin API. Plugins targeting 3.2+ must use the new name or rotation hooks will not fire. The old name is ignored silently — no deprecation warning is emitted. Update your `.env` before upgrading. Keep `KS_PLUGIN_DIR` and `KS_LOG_LEVEL` as-is. Immediately after those entries, add the renamed token line with your existing value.

secret setting of kawif-kajef: COURIER_KEY3=d2b

// MAX_PARITY_DELTA_CENTS: threshold for the Quillstone rate-parity checker.
// If a partner channel's nightly rate differs from our direct rate by more
// than this amount, the property gets flagged for review. Do not lower it
// without checking the false-positive report first — small rounding gaps
// from currency conversion are expected and harmless. The value was last
// tuned against the regression suite run on the build noted below.

trace token, fafog-kageg: htk4_98e6

Goods Lift — Contractor Notes. The goods lift at Harmont House serves deliveries only. Do not use it for personal travel between floors. Book slots through the loading-bay desk before 09:00. Pallets must be strapped; loose cartons go on trolleys. Maximum load 800 kg. Report faults to the facilities desk on level 1. The lift lobby door on the ground floor requires the pass code below.

turnstile pass: bdg-FVNQRS-72965873

## Releases

Hey support folks — quick notes on ProfileMesh shard releases. Each release re-balances user-profile shards gradually, so don't panic if a lookup lands on a stale shard for a few minutes post-deploy; it self-heals. Release bundles are published twice a month and are always signed. If a customer asks you to verify a bundle they downloaded, walk them through the checksum step using the public signing key below.

deploy key for kawif-bageg: bky19_YQNdHDgpaLxUNwPoHm9